My name is Hit. I'm from Universe 6, and I am a professional assassin through and through. Over the course of my centuries-long career, I have never failed a mission. But today... for the first time, I failed.

...

"Why weren't you moving just now?" Trunks looked at Hit with genuine confusion.

Hit's face instantly darkened, as if someone had stepped directly on a landmine. 

"What do you mean 'I wasn't moving?'!" 

His eyes twitched violently. He felt deeply insulted. "Are you mocking me?"

Hit gritted his teeth so hard that his jaw creaked, his fists clenching until they crackled. Yet despite his anger, a powerful sense of curiosity suddenly rose within him. 

This seemingly ordinary guy had effortlessly broken through the Space Prison, a technique that Hit had spent centuries developing. The unprecedented setback forced him to reevaluate Trunks.

After a fierce internal struggle, Hit slowly loosened his fists. Taking a deep breath to calm himself, he asked in a serious voice, "Who exactly are you?"

Trunks quietly looked at Hit's solemn expression. Truthfully, he didn't have a bad impression of him; in the original story, Hit had eventually become friends with Son Goku. With that in mind, Trunks decided not to hide anything.

"I'm from Universe 7. My name is Trunks."

Hit slowly closed his eyes, searching through his memories for that name. A moment later, he opened them again, certain this was their first meeting. Which only made things more confusing. If they had never met before, how did Trunks know so much about his abilities?

Filled with questions, Hit asked again, "How exactly did you break my Space Prison?" His gaze sharpened like a pair of blades, desperate for an answer.

Unfortunately, Trunks didn't know the answer himself. Since Hit seemed so eager to hear something, he could only offer a vague response. 

"Break it? I wouldn't really call it that. After all, you're still the master of this space, aren't you?" He pointed toward the Man in Black and Super Perfect Cell. "They still can't move without your permission, right?"

Hit's face darkened. That wasn't an answer at all. 

"...Forget it," he muttered quietly.

Whoosh!

In an instant, he appeared behind Trunks. As a veteran assassin, approaching a target silently was second nature to him. Using the methods he had refined over countless years, Hit carefully raised his hand. 

A beam of energy flickered at his fingertips, emitting a chilling glow as it aimed directly at Trunks' neck. With the slightest movement, the lethal beam would pierce straight through his throat.

To ensure the strike landed perfectly, Hit held his breath, his full attention locked onto Trunks. Not a single flaw could be allowed. 

His body remained completely still; even the slightest muscle movement was under precise control. For that brief moment, he seemed to merge with the surrounding environment itself.

But while a person could stop breathing through willpower... they couldn't stop their heart. Hidden inside his chest, Hit's heart continued beating steadily.

'Thump.'

'Thump.'

'Thump.'

In the silence, those faint sounds became surprisingly clear. At that moment, Trunks casually glanced to the side. With his extraordinary perception, he instantly noticed something unusual behind him. 

A faint heartbeat entered Trunks' ears; it was incredibly weak, barely noticeable, but for Trunks, that was more than enough to raise his guard. Almost instantly, he spun around with lightning speed and threw a heavy punch straight behind him. The attack was as fast as a gale and just as fierce.

When Trunks fully turned around, the first thing he saw was Hit's face, a face overflowing with confidence. Just how confident was he? The moment Trunks turned to face him, Hit didn't even blink. 

His eyes remained firmly locked on Trunks as though victory was already guaranteed. Even when Trunks' fist came flying toward him, Hit's gaze never wavered. A trace of amusement even lingered at the corner of his mouth. 

Everything about him radiated absolute confidence. It was as if he already knew the punch would land on him, and simply didn't care.

Then, suddenly, Hit's body became transparent. It was as though he had vanished from this space entirely, briefly stepping out of reality itself. That was the source of his confidence; he believed there was no need to dodge because Trunks couldn't possibly hit him.

BOOM!!

A heavy impact echoed through the Space Prison. Hit immediately looked down at his stomach in disbelief. Trunks' fist was firmly planted against his abdomen, in fact, it was still pushing deeper, as though it were sinking into his body.

"H-How is that possible?!" Hit cried out in shock. The more confident he had been moments ago, the more miserable his expression became now, a giant question mark practically appearing over his head. Before he could process what had happened, his entire body was sent flying.

Boom!

Hit clutched his stomach tightly, his body trembling violently as he struggled to rise from the ground. The moment he opened his mouth, a stream of blood burst out. 

The crimson blood splattered across the earth, forming a pool beneath him, while some of it turned into a fine mist that drifted through the air like a thin veil of red covering his already dazed eyes.

"You... you..." Hit stared at Trunks in disbelief. "How did you do that?!" 

His voice was hoarse, tinged with fear. 

"W-Why is my Void Technique completely ineffective against you...?" He gasped for breath between words, unable to understand what was happening.

Meanwhile, Trunks looked just as confused. A moment ago, he had clearly seen Hit's body become blurry and intangible, as though entering some special state. 

But what surprised him was how brief it had been. Just how brief? From Trunks' perspective, it had lasted for only the tiniest instant, so short that it might as well never have happened at all.

Hit's body suddenly trembled. "Could it be..." He closed his eyes and carefully sensed the energy within the man standing before him.

Then, abruptly, his eyes flew open. "I... I see now." Realization dawned on his face.
